Languedoc-Roussillon, located in the south of France, is a renowned wine region celebrated for its diverse range of wines and exceptional terroir. Under the PGI (Protected Geographical Indication) appellation, this region offers a wide selection of accessible and quality wines, often at very competitive prices.
PGI Languedoc-Roussillon wines are crafted from a rich blend of grape varieties, such as Grenache, Syrah, Mourvèdre, Carignan, and Cinsault for reds, and Vermentino, Grenache Blanc, and Roussanne for whites. The reds are generally full-bodied with notes of ripe fruits and spices, while the whites are often fresh and aromatic with floral and citrus notes. The region enjoys a Mediterranean climate, ideal for viticulture, with hot, dry summers and mild winters.
